Our world-renowned pastry chef Jean Claude Canestrier will even make you and yours a personalized cake.Vegas Wedding Facts - Wonder what made Las Vegas the ‘wedding capitol of the world’? These facts and figures probably had a little something to do with it.
- Approximately 315 weddings are performed here each day.
- New Year's Eve and Valentine's Day are the most popular days for weddings in Vegas.
- 128,000 couples married on or near the Las Vegas Strip in 2004.
- Las Vegas' marriage licensing bureau is open till midnight.
- Triple digit-dates are also popular to marry on in Vegas. 12-12-12 will be the last until the year 3001.
Famous Vegas Weddings - If you need any more convincing to hold your wedding festivities here in our fair city, check out some of the famous names who have said ‘I Do’ here too.
- Frank Sinatra and Mia Farrow at the Sands - July 19, 1966
- Elvis Presley and Priscilla at the original Aladdin Hotel - May 1, 1967
- Dennis Rodman and Carmen Electra at Little Chapel of the Flowers - November 15, 1998
- Angelina Jolie and Billy Bob Thornton at the Little Church of the West - May 5, 2000
- Britney Spears and Jason Alexander at the Little White Wedding Chapel - January 3, 2004
